Benzyl alcohol for head lice infestation & cold sores

Benzyl alcohol causes asphyxiation of lice by obstructing the respiratory spiracles of the lice.

It is used for the treatment of head lice infestations in adults and children 6 months of age or more.

It is also used for the temporary relief of pain from cold sores, canker sores, fever blisters, mouth sores, and gum irritations.

Benzyl Alcohol Dose in Adults

Dose in the treatment of Oral pain:

  • Apply the topical gel to the affected area up to four times a day.

Dose in the treatment of Head lice:

  • Apply appropriate volume for hair length of the lotion to dry hair.
  • leave on for ten minutes and rinse thoroughly with water.
  • Reapply in seven days.
    • Hair length 0 - 2 inches:
      • 4 - 6 ounces
    • Hair length 2 - 4 inches:
      • 6 - 8 ounces
    • Hair length 4 - 8 inches:
      • 8 - 12 ounces
    • Hair length 8 - 16 inches:
      • 12 - 24 ounces
    • Hair length 16 - 22 inches:
      • 24 - 32 ounces
    • Hair length more than 22 inches:
      • 32 - 48 ounces

Benzyl Alcohol Dose in Childrens

Dose in the treatment of Head lice:

  • Infants older than 6 months, Children, and Adolescents:
    • Apply the appropriate volume of the lotion (ulesfia) ( appropriate for hair length) to dry hair and leave on for ten minutes.
    • Rinse thoroughly with water and repeat in seven days.
      • Hair length 0 - 2 inches:
        • 4 - 6 ounces
      • Hair length 2 - 4 inches:
        • 6 - 8 ounces
      • Hair length 4 - 8 inches:
        • 8 - 12 ounces
      • Hair length 8 - 16 inches:
        • 12 - 24 ounces
      • Hair length 16 - 22 inches:
        • 24 - 32 ounces
      • Hair length more than 22 inches:
        • 32 - 48 ounces

Dose in the treatment of Oral pain:

  • Children older than 2 years and Adolescents:
    • Apply the topical gel (zilactin) to the affected area up to four times a day.
    • It should not be used for more than 7 days.

Pregnancy Risk Factor B

  • Animal reproduction studies have not shown any adverse effects.

Use of benzyl alcohol during breastfeeding

  • Breastmilk excretion is unknown.
  • Nursing women should use it with caution

Benzyl Alcohol Dose in Renal Disease:

  • Adjustment in the dose has not been recommended by the manufacturer in patients with renal disease.

Benzyl Alcohol Dose in Liver Disease:

  • Adjustment in the dose has not been recommended by the manufacturer in patients with liver disease.

Common Side Effects Of Benzyl alcohol Include:

  • Dermatologic:
    • Pruritus
    • Erythema

Less Common Side Effects of Benzyl alcohol Include:

  • Central nervous system:
    • Local anesthesia
    • Hypoesthesia
  • Local:
    • Local irritation
    • Local pain
  • Ophthalmic:
    • Eye irritation

Contraindication to Benzyl alcohol Include:

  • Contrainidcations are not listed on the label.

Warnings and Precautions​​​​​​​

  • Contact dermatitis:
    • It is possible to get allergic contact dermatitis.
  • Eye irritation:
    • Avoid eye exposure
    • Inadvertent exposures must be flushed immediately with water.

How to administer Benzyl alcohol?

It should be used for topical purposes only.

  • Gel:

    • It is applied with a moistened cotton swab or finger to the dry affected area.
    • After application, allow to dry for 30 - 60 seconds.
    • To remove the film, first, apply another coat of benzyl alcohol, and then immediately wipe the area with a moist gauze pad or tissue.
  • Lotion:

    • The lotion should be applied to dried hair.
    • Leave the lotion for 10 minutes, followed by a thorough water rinse.
    • Avoid contact with eyes and inflamed mucosa.
    • Wash hands after application.
    • It should be used in conjunction with other therapies.
    • Other measures include dry cleaning or washing all clothing, hats, bedding, and towels including personal items like combs, brushes, hair clips in hot water.
    • May use a fine-tooth or special nit comb to remove nits and dead lice.

Mechanism of action of Benzyl alcohol:

  • It blocks the respiratory spiracles, inhibiting the respiration and causing lice asphyxiation. It has no ovicidal activities.
